Features:
• +4dBu balanced line (1/4" tip-ring-sleeve and XLR inputs and outputs)
• +23dBu headroom
• Active balanced outputs
• Hardwire bypass
• Bypass switch for comparison of processed to unprocessed signal

Specifications:
• Frequency Response,
• Process Mode: Program controlled
• Bypass Mode: 10Hz to 50kHz, +/- 0.5dBu, 0dBu input
• Signal to Noise Ratio: 115dB Process IN
• THD, Process mode: less than 0.025% 20-20kHz
• Bypass mode: less than 0.002% 20-20kHz
• Maximum Output: +23dBu (may vary due to control settings)
• Input Impedance: 14.7K Ohms, balanced 1/4" stereo phone jack or XLR jack.
• Pin #2 is the hot or "+" signal.
• Output Impedance: 600 Ohms, balanced 1/4" stereo phone jack or XLR jack.
• Pin #2 is the hot or "+" signal.
• Sensitivity: -45dBu for maximum process
• Maximum Process: +12dBu boost at 5kHz, 0dBu input
• Lo Contour: +12dBu adjustment at 50Hz, 0dBu input
